Donald Trump on Tuesday morning won all nine delegates in the Northern Mariana Islands Republican presidential caucus.

Jason Osborne, the executive director of the Northern Mariana Islands Republican Party, announced Trump’s victory on Twitter.

Trump won 343 votes of the 471 individuals who participated in the caucus, awarding him all nine delegates, according to USA Today. Sen. Ted Cruz (R-TX) received 113 votes, Ohio Gov. John Kasich received 10 votes, and Sen. Marco Rubio (R-FL) received five votes, according to USA Today.
